Heavy rain, strong winds expected today: Environment Canada

Total rainfall amounts of 25 to 40 mm and strong wind gusts near 80 km/h are possible, Environment Canada says

Rainfall Warning in effect for:

  • Sault Ste. Marie - St. Joseph Island
  • Searchmont - Montreal River Harbour - Batchawana Bay

Rain, heavy at times is expected. The frozen ground has a reduced ability to absorb this rainfall.

Hazard: Total rainfall amounts of 25 to 40 mm. Strong wind gusts near 80 km/h. Timing: Rain winding down Friday night. Strong winds Friday morning to Friday evening.

Discussion: Rain is expected to begin early this evening before tapering off Friday night. The heaviest rainfall is expected Friday morning. Northwesterly winds will strengthen Friday morning with gusts to 80 km/h possible Friday afternoon. The strong winds should gradually weaken Friday evening.

For information concerning flooding, please consult your local Conservation Authority or Ontario Ministry of Natural Resources and Forestry Office. Visit Ontario.ca/floods for the latest details. Utility outages may occur. High winds may toss loose objects or cause tree branches to break. Localized flooding in low-lying areas is possible.

Heavy downpours can cause flash floods and water pooling on roads. If visibility is reduced while driving, slow down, watch for tail lights ahead and be prepared to stop.
